Finding the Right Floor Coating for Your Area

What method can one use to determine the most fitting floor coating for a given environment? Selecting the correct floor coating necessitates careful consideration of diverse factors. First, individuals should examine the space's function; residential areas may stress aesthetics, while industrial settings might focus on durability and safety. Next, grasping the foot traffic levels is vital, as coatings differ in resilience. Environmental conditions, including moisture and temperature fluctuations, also play a major role in coating selection.

Moreover, the substrate type under the coating can shape adhesion performance. For example, concrete surfaces may need specific sealers or primers. One must also evaluate care needs; some coatings necessitate routine maintenance while others provide low-maintenance solutions. Financial constraints are just as important, as costs can differ significantly among materials. Ultimately, a thoroughly informed choice requires harmonizing functionality, aesthetics, and cost-effectiveness to achieve the desired outcome.

Epoxy Floor Sealers

Epoxy floor coatings prove to be a superior choice for high-traffic areas due to their exceptional durability and endurance. Made from a combination of epoxy resins and hardeners, these coatings build a solid surface that can tolerate heavy foot and vehicle traffic without displaying deterioration. The uninterrupted installation curtails joints and seams, reducing the probability of water infiltration and mold growth. Additionally, epoxy coatings supply impressive resistance to chemicals, stains, and impacts, making them well-suited for industrial, commercial, and residential environments. Their glossy finish upgrades aesthetics while supplying slip resistance, enhancing safety. Overall, epoxy floor coatings give a workable and aesthetically attractive solution for spaces requiring long-lasting performance.

Tips for Applying to Longevity Initiatives

When applying green floor coatings, careful attention to detail is needed to guarantee reliable results. Proper surface preparation is important; this involves cleaning and mending any imperfections to ensure optimal adhesion. Temperature and humidity levels should be monitored, as they greatly affect drying times and curing processes. Employing top-notch applicators like rollers or brushes can improve the finish and ensure uniform application. Applying multiple thin coats is preferable than one thick layer because it lowers bubbling risk and increases durability. It is also vital to allow adequate drying time between coats, following the manufacturer's guidelines. Finally, regular maintenance, including cleaning with gentle, eco-friendly products, will help prolong the life of the coating and maintain its aesthetic appeal.

Affordable Flooring Options

Numerous homeowners search for budget-friendly floor solutions that supply both strength and visual charm. Vinyl plank flooring has risen in popularity due to its water resistance and range of finishes, emulating natural wood or stone without the high cost. Laminate flooring presents a similar aesthetic, presenting a durable surface that resists dings and wear, making it fitting for high-traffic areas.

Moreover, cork flooring is an sustainable alternative, known for its comfort and insulation properties. It is also resistant to mold and mildew, ideal for humid environments. For those interested in an even more affordable solution, painted concrete can reimagine a basic slab into a chic floor, permitting for creative designs.

These selections not only remain within budget constraints but also offer the necessary durability to withstand everyday deterioration, showing that quality flooring can be accessible without forgoing style.

Your New Floor Coating Installation How-To

Putting in a new surface finish demands meticulous planning and attention to detail to ensure a lasting finish. First, the existing floor must be thoroughly cleaned to eliminate dust, dirt, and any impurities. This may involve sweeping, vacuuming, and mopping. Once the surface is clean, any cracks or imperfections should be fixed to ensure a smooth base.

Next, the correct primer should be used, customized to the distinct type of coating decided upon. Following the primer's drying duration, the actual flooring finish can be spread using a roller or brush, ensuring consistent application. It is important to follow the company's directives regarding coat thickness and drying duration.

When the first layer has hardened, a extra coat could be necessary for added durability. Finally, ensuring sufficient curing time before heavy foot traffic is crucial to maintain the integrity of the new floor coating.

Straightforward Tips for Maintaining Your Floors Looking Wonderful

Upon successfully installing a new floor coating, maintaining appearances matters most. Frequent cleaning is required; daily sweeping or vacuuming takes away dirt and debris that can scratch the surface. For intensive cleaning, applying a pH-neutral cleaner with a damp mop maintains the coating's finish without causing damage.

Furthermore, positioning mats at entryways reduces the amount of dirt tracked onto the floors. It is recommended to avoid harsh chemicals and abrasive tools, as they can wear down the coating over time. Spills should be cleaned promptly to prevent staining.

In addition, routine examinations for wear patterns can help catch defects before they worsen. If necessary, administering a new application of sealant can rejuvenate the floor's condition and extend its lifespan. By implementing these basic care tips, one can confirm that their floor coating remains presentable and functional for years to come to come.

Often Requested Questions

How Long Can You Expect Different Floor Coatings to Last?

Multiple floor coatings typically persist between five to twenty years, determined by the material and usage. For instance, epoxy can last up to ten years, while polyurethane may endure up to twenty with regular care.

Is it feasible to put Floor Coatings Over Existing Flooring?

Yes, floor coatings can regularly be installed over existing flooring, if the surface is clean, moisture-free, and properly maintained. Proper preparation is important to guarantee strong bonding and durability of the new coating.

What Upkeep Is Needed for Various Flooring Finishes?

Maintenance for floor coatings differs: epoxy needs frequent cleaning and periodic recoating, while polyurethane requires gentle cleaning without strong chemicals. Vinyl coatings typically need basic sweeping and mopping to preserve their look and durability.

What Health Risks Are Related to Floor Coatings?

Various flooring finishes may create health dangers, such as breathing problems or skin irritation, primarily due to volatile organic compounds (VOCs). Proper air circulation and compliance with safety protocols can minimize these possible risks during use and application.

How Do Temperature and Humidity Influence Floor Coating Effectiveness?

Temperature and humidity greatly influence floor coating performance. High humidity may prolong cure duration, while extreme temperatures can affect adhesion and cure rates, potentially leading to reduced longevity and visual quality over time.
